TRQ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review
129 of the 5,937 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Turquoise Hill Resources Ltd (TRQ)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$1.86B — down 14% from $2.17B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 29 funds closed out of TRQ and 26 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 38 trimmed existing stakes and 41 added.
The largest buyer was Madison Avenue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$35M. The largest seller was L1 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$81.6M sold.
